Whether you’re a three-mile stretch kind of man or more of a seasoned marathon runner, the right kit is almost as important as the exercise itself – so it’s time give your workout wardrobe a seasonal update. We’ve already heroed some front-runners for your feet and Nike’s techiest long-sleeved tees, so next up it’s three high-performing pairs of shorts engineered to keep you cool and dry, and guaranteed to help you go the distance in style.

The sweat reducers
You can trace Reebok’s running gear back to 1895, so it’s no surprise to see the brand still producing some of the best activewear out there. Its black 2-In-1 shorts come with fluorescent form-fitting inner shorts cut from Speedwick fabric that actually draws sweat away from the body.

Wear with all black to create a sleek silhouette, or try a grey tee up top and textured kicks for a more interesting option.

The khaki ones
Next up it’s a pair of shorts that prove you don’t have to stick to a completely black aesthetic to look like you know what you’re doing. The Nike Running 7 Pursuit 2-In-1s boast all the high-tech features you’ve come to expect but with the added bonus of some steezy colour.

Sure, moisture-managing Dri-FIT fabric, inbuilt briefs and perforated patches are impressive, but a khaki-green outer and contrasting cobalt-blue inner are what give these guys an edge. Go for a matching tee to tie your outfit together.

The OG ones
Or, if your gym style is a bit more OG, then Polo Ralph Lauren’s logo shorts will be a welcome addition to your arsenal. This pair have all the hallmarks of an old-school classic – fleece-back sweat, a longer straight cut and deeper side pockets.

Be sure to balance things out up top with an oversized tee to allow for some extra ventilation. Try a Ralph top to keep things high-grade, or go for a baggy printed tee to mix things up.
